In this episode of This Ain’t Sunday Morning, the crew dives into spiritual warfare in a practical, relatable way, showing that it’s not just demons, fear, or dramatic moments, but the daily battles of temptation, conviction, habits, and lifestyle choices that pull us away from God. Using the story of No Malice from Clipse as a modern example, the conversation explores how fame, success, and culture can conflict with faith, how conviction can transform identity, and how God meets us in our struggle to make us new. The episode breaks down what spiritual warfare really looks like, how to recognize when God is tugging at your heart, and what steps to take when you feel called to change. The crew also challenges the church to support, not shame, those who are wrestling and growing, reminding listeners that God can redeem any story.
